Abstract

It is clear that a channel state information (CSI) influences performance of communication systems. Therefore, researching on impact of the CSI on the system performance and developing new techniques for the state of the art communication systems under different CSI conditions attract the great attention of researchers. In this paper, we analyze the performance of system which shares redundancy and combines designs of precoder and equalizer. Furthermore, the proposed system is evaluated based on imperfect CSI at the receiver and calculation results have proved the strong impact of channel estimation error on the system capacity. © 2019 IEEE.
